🇸🇰 Ľubomír Višňovský Retires Following Slovan Elimination

Slovak mainstay defenceman Ľubomír Višňovský announced his retirement from HC Slovan following a 4-0 sweep at the hands of CSKA Moscow, wrapping up a 20+ year career in both Slovakia and the NHL.

🇸🇰 Mutiny In Slovak Hockey Association Over Nemeček Reelection

Following what many saw as a controversial reelection of Igor Nemeček as the head of the Slovak Ice Hockey Association (SZHL), a number of prominent Slovakian players have pledged to boycott the national team under Nemeček’s leadership.
